The weather here doesn't do garage doors any favors. Salt air from Quincy Bay accelerates rust on springs and hardware. Winter freeze-thaw cycles wreak havoc on door seals and opener sensors. We see more broken springs in Quincy during February and March than any other time of year. Those springs typically last 7 to 9 years with normal use, not the 10 to 15 years some manufacturers claim.
North Quincy and Quincy Center properties face unique challenges due to age and density. Many driveways are shorter, which means garage doors get used more frequently (sometimes 8 to 10 cycles per day). That kind of usage wears out rollers, cables, and openers faster than the national average. If you hear grinding or see the door shaking during operation, those are early warning signs we can address before you're stuck with a door that won't budge.
Our spring replacement service is our most common call in Quincy. A broken torsion spring means your door isn't going anywhere, and trying to force it can damage the opener or bend the door panels. We carry high-cycle springs on every truck, so we complete most spring jobs in under an hour.
Garage door opener installation is where we see homeowners really improve their daily routine.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models with battery backup and smartphone connectivity. Modern openers are quieter and more reliable than units from even five years ago. If your opener is struggling to lift the door or making loud grinding noises, replacement usually makes more sense than repair once the unit hits 12 to 15 years old.
Cable and roller repair keeps doors running smoothly. Frayed cables are a safety hazard. We replace them in pairs because if one side has failed, the other isn't far behind. Worn rollers create that loud rumbling sound that echoes through your house every time the door moves. We upgrade to nylon rollers when possible since they're quieter and last longer than steel.
Full door replacement becomes necessary when panels are dented beyond repair or the door no longer insulates properly. We'll walk you through insulation values, window options, and style choices that match your home. Installation typically takes half a day for a standard two-car garage.

Can you fix a garage door that's off its tracks?
Absolutely. A door off its tracks is dangerous and needs immediate attention. This usually happens from impact damage or broken cables. We realign the door, inspect for bent tracks or damaged rollers, and make sure everything is safe before we leave. This repair typically takes 60 to 90 minutes depending on the damage.
How much does spring replacement cost in Quincy?
Torsion spring replacement typically runs $225 to $295 for a standard two-car garage door, depending on spring size and door weight. That includes labor, new springs, and a full safety inspection. Extension spring replacement is usually $175 to $225. We provide exact quotes before starting work, and you can see our full FAQ for more pricing details.
